SPIN HALL EFFECT IN ULTRACOLD ATOMIC GAS

    https://doi.org/10.1142/9789812794185_0040Cited by:0 (Source: Crossref)
    Abstract:

    In this paper we discuss the spin Hall effect (SHE) in cold atoms through optical coherent control means. We first briefly introduce the concepts of spin-orbit coupling and SHE in solid systems and then discuss the optical means in creating adiabatic gauge field for neutral atomic system. The optically induced SHE are then presented.
